      majid,
      i suppose u have used scanline render option for 3dMax?? KT uses a different apprach from the 3dmax scanline render.. it takes into account GI (global illumination) if u were to use Vray or Mray for max the results would be similar to what see in KT.

      i dont know much bout importing to max but for KT i suggest using Su2KT (which i am sure u are using! 😳 )

      the problem u mentioned about KT not showing large objects or very small objects is an issue of the Open GL. if u are using su2kt and render from the cam positions it should be fine.. only thing is the viewer inside KT would be all messed up..

      another small thing.. if rendering HUUUUGE scenes i would suggest using Unbiased render methods such as PPT or BPT or MLT. thats becoz PM+FG has certain limitations for rendering huuuge meshes..

          PM = photon mapping,
          PPT = path tracing (progressive)
          BPT = bidirectional path tracing
          MLT = Metropolis Light Trasfer

          these are the different render presets available in KT! the best of both biased and unbiased worlds! πŸ˜‰ 😎
